unreferenced date March 2010 IT assetmanagement ITAM is the set of business practices that join financial, contractual and inventory functions to support Product life cycle management life cycle management and strategic decision making for the IT environment. Assets include all elements of Computer software software and Computer hardware hardware that are found in the business environment. Hardware assetmanagement Hardware assetmanagement entails the management of the physical components of computers and Computer networking computer networks , from acquisition through disposal. Common business practices include request and approval process, procurement management, product life cycle management life cycle management, redeployment and disposal management. A key component is capturing the financial information about the hardware life cycle which aids the organization in making business decisions based on meaningful and measurable financial objectives. Software AssetManagement is a similar process, focusing on software assets, including licenses, versions and installed endpoints. Cleanup rewrite date May 2009 In banking, asset and liability management is the practice of managing risk s that arise due to mismatches between the assets and liabilities debts and assets of the bank. This can also be seen in insurance. Banks face several risks such as the liquidity risk , interest rate risk , credit risk and operational risk . Asset liability management ALM is a strategic management tool to manage interest rate risk and liquidity risk faced by bank s, other financial services companies and corporation s. Refimprove date March 2011 Digital assetmanagement DAM consists of management tasks and decisions surrounding the ingestion, annotation, cataloguing, storage, retrieval and distribution of digital asset s. Digital photograph s, animations, videos and music exemplify the target areas of media assetmanagement a sub category of DAM ref van Niekerk, A.J. 2006 . Primary sources date May 2011 infobox company name Acadian AssetManagement type Subsidiary of Old Mutual logo Image Acadian logo.gif 94px Acadian AssetManagement fate predecessor successor foundation 1977 founder defunct location Boston, Massachusetts locations area served key people industry Financial services products Investment management services revenue operating income net income aum assets equity owner num employees homepage http www.acadian asset.com www.acadian asset.com intl Acadian AssetManagement LLC , known as Acadian AssetManagement until 31 December 2007, is a company in the financial services industry. It is a global equity manager its clients include institutions, such as public and private pension plans, governments, foundations, and private individuals. It also sub advises several mutual fund s. Ownership and operations Acadian AssetManagement LLC is a wholly owned subsidiary of Old Mutual , a London based financial services company. Acadian s corporate headquarters are located in Boston, Massachusetts , with U.S. operations located there. Acadian also has operations in Singapore , London , and a joint venture in Australia . Company history Acadian Financial Research, the firm s predecessor was founded in 1977. Starting in 1978, Acadian designed, developed and implemented an international index matching strategy and later an active country selection strategy for the State Street Bank and Trust Company. Orphan date February 2009 Assetmanagement within the context of social housing in the UK is a relatively new specialism. It pertains to the function within a Housing Association , Arms Length Management Organisation or council house Local Authority housing department that is responsible for the long term management of social housing stock. The aim of social housing is to provide housing that is affordable to people or tenants on low incomes. Assetmanagement is a strategic planning tool driven by stock condition data to forecast future costs of maintaining housing stock. Often this includes the management of asbestos data. There are two systems that play a vital role in the management of your housing stock. These are your housing management and assetmanagement systems. 1 Housing Management an operational management tool that deals with among other things rent collection, allocations, estates, repairs, tenant enquiries and contractors and is generally the core system used by a social landlord. 2 AssetManagement a strategic planning tool driven by stock condition data to forecast future costs of maintaining housing stock. Often this includes the management of asbestos data. This includes projecting future costs to maintain housing stock at the required standard in England this is the Decent Homes Standard , managing programmes of capital investment and undertaking stock options appraisals to understand when it might be beneficial to sell or demolish stock rather than maintain it . Unreferenced stub auto yes date December 2009 An AssetManagement Company AMC is an investment management firm that invests the pooled funds of retail investors in securities in line with the stated investment objectives. For a fee, the investment company provides more Diversity business diversification , liquidity , and professional management consulting service than is normally available to individual investors. The diversification of portfolio is done by investing in such securities which are inversely correlated to each other. Unreferenced date October 2011 Asset Integrity Management Systems AIMS outline the ability of an Physical plant asset to perform its required Function engineering function effectively and efficiently whilst protecting Health, Safety and Environment health, safety and the environment and the means of ensuring that the people, systems, processes and resources that deliver Maintenance, repair, and operations integrity are in place, in use and will perform when required over the whole lifecycle of the asset. An Integrity Management System should address the quality at every stage of the Enterprise life cycle asset life cycle , from the Process Design design of new facilities to maintenance management to wikt decommissioning decomissioning . Inspection s, auditing assurance and overall quality management quality processes are just some of the tools designed to make an integrity management system effective. The AIMS should also endeavour to maintain the asset in a fit for service condition while extending its remaining life in the most reliable, safe, and cost effective manner. The AIM programs should attempt to meet API 580 , API 581 , and PAS 55 requirements, as applicable. The AIMS document will stipulate the requirements for subsequent Integrity Management Plan s. Asset Integrity management improves plant reliability and safety whilst reducing un planned maintenance and repair costs. Infobox Defunct Company company name Mercury AssetManagement plc company logo File Mercuryassetmanagement.png slogan fate Acquired successor Merrill Lynch foundation 1969 defunct 1997 location London , United Kingdom UK industry Investment Investment management key people Hugh Stevenson Chairman , Carol Galley Vice Chairman , Stephen Zimmerman Deputy Chairman products num employees 1,300 parent subsid Mercury AssetManagement plc was a leading United Kingdom British investment investment management business. It was listed on the London Stock Exchange and was a constituent of the FTSE 100 Index . History The Company was established in 1969 when S. G. Warburg & Co. , the investment bank, won an investment management contract and set up Warburg Investment Management to execute it. In 1987 25 of the business was floated on the London Stock Exchange as Mercury AssetManagement .
